Job Description

Job Description

You'll be embedded in a cross-functional team working on customer-facing products and internal AI workflows. You'll collaborate with a team of 5 UX strategists and 1 FTE AI Designer and be mentored by the lead UX strategist/AI Designer. You'll be assigned to a project and work closely with the hiring manager to define priorities. Responsibilities include supporting innovation design, assessing AI opportunities in the market, and identifying design efficiencies. You'll also help define and document best practices for AI design across multiple initiatives.

Skills and Requirements

  • 5+ years of professional experience, with 1+ years of hands-on experience with Generative AI and conversational AI design

  • Proficiency in AI design principles and experience designing user-facing AI experiences

  • Familiarity with LLM models (e.g., GPT, Claude, Mistral, CoPilot) and ability to write and test system prompts

  • Understanding of the full AI product lifecycle, from design to production

  • Strong communication skills and ability to work with multiple stakeholders, challenge assumptions, and recommend best practices
